Precipitated Calcium Carbonate. PCC stands for Precipitated Calcium Carbonate—also known as purified, refined or synthetic calcium carbonate. It has the same chemical formula as other types of calcium carbonate, such as limestone, marble and chalk: CaCO3. The calcium, carbon and oxygen atoms can arrange themselves in three different ways, to form three different calcium carbonate .

Gulshan Polyols Ltd is the first to introduce the concept of Onsite PCC plant in India, Precipitated Calcium Carbonate is produced in a satellite facility; onsite or close to a paper mill and the resultant slurry is pumped directly to the mill.

Calcium helps plant cells communicate with each other by physically moving between cell membranes. Not only is it integral in the basic structure of plants, with a deficiency often showing up as thick, woody stems, its largely responsible for the availability of nutrients in plants and has a strong influence on microbial activity.

A deficiency of calcium causes dieback of growing tips, in both roots and tops, and causes cell membranes to lose their impermeability and to disintegrate. Roots are short, thick and bulbous, also symptomatic of aluminum toxicity. Calcium In The Soil. The low ability of the plant to take up calcium coincides with the large amount in most soils.

Dec 10, 2008· Calcium is an alkaline material widely distributed in the earth. It is the fifth most abundant element (by mass), usually found in sedimentary rocks in the mineral forms of calcite, dolomite and gypsum. [1] We often see it as marble or limestone, which is formed by calcium carbonate rock dissolved in water containing carbon dioxide.
